Image Intensifier Tube Market Overview

The Image Intensifier Tube Market refers to the commercial landscape of components designed to amplify low-light level images to visible levels, making them crucial for applications requiring enhanced night or low-light vision. These tubes are integral in devices such as night vision goggles, scopes, cameras, and medical imaging systems.

An image intensifier tube operates by collecting photons through a photocathode, converting them to electrons, amplifying them through a microchannel plate, and converting them back into visible light via a phosphor screen. These tubes are extensively used in:

  • Military: For night vision equipment, scopes, and goggles.
  • Healthcare: Used in fluoroscopy and other diagnostic imaging.
  • Electronics and Semiconductors: For device inspection and precision applications.

Three main generations define the technological evolution:

  • Generation I: Basic night vision with limited sensitivity.
  • Generation II: Better resolution and performance.
  • Generation III: Advanced tubes with greater clarity and performance, often used in military and defense.

The evolution in materials, such as gallium arsenide photocathodes, and improved power efficiency have further defined the direction of the market.

Image Intensifier Tube Key Market Trends  :
  1. Rise in Military Modernization Programs
    Increasing investments in defense and night vision technologies are driving demand for advanced image intensifier tubes.
  2. Healthcare Imaging Innovation
    Use of image intensifier tubes in medical diagnostics, especially for low-light imaging in X-ray systems, is steadily growing.
  3. Technological Advancements in Generation III Tubes
    Enhanced performance and improved resolution in Gen III tubes are gaining traction in both military and commercial sectors.
  4. Expansion of Night Vision Applications
    Broader adoption in security, surveillance, and wildlife monitoring is influencing market growth.
  5. Growth in Emerging Economies
    Countries like India, South Korea, and Vietnam are witnessing increased deployment of night vision devices, driving regional growth.
